Interview about the SADC Council of Ministers virtual meeting which was hosted by Mozambique as the incoming Chair of SADC. The discussion reviews the SADC Council of Ministers’ meeting agenda which focused on the SADC Executive Secretary resport, SADC Secretariat matters as well as progress towards continental and regional integration, report on the socio-economic impact of COVID-19 and its implications in the SADC Region, and the development of the SADC Post 2020 Agenda by the SADC Vision 2050 and the Revised Regional Indicative Strategic Development Plan (RISDP) 2020-2030. The discussion evaluates the role of the SADC Secretariat in resolving regional issues and whether the issue of the Zimbabwean crisis will be on the agenda. The interview also discusses the dual conflicts in Zimbabwe and Mozambique which affect regional security and the recovery from COVID-19.
